SERIES CONCEPT

Publications Coordinators plan, schedule and coordinate the 
production of books, publications, and other printed material; 
confer with editors, designers, project directors and related 
personnel in the preparation of proposed publications; verify 
that format of copy conforms to printing specifications; and 
perform other related duties as required.

CLASS CONCEPTS

Principal Publications Coordinator

Under direction, incumbents direct and coordinate the production 
of publications; evaluate and monitor University or vendor 
services used in the production of publications; assign tasks to 
related personnel; and may estimate costs for services.

Typically at this level incumbents coordinate and review work 
load distribution; arrange contracts with manufacturers and 
suppliers; review work orders for due dates and set priority 
schedules; control workflow; and coordinate and direct the 
monitoring of all orders beginning with creative production, 
through contracts with vendors and final printing production.

Position must supervise a minimum of 2 FTE and meet all other 
criteria for FLSA executive exemption.

Senior Publications Coordinator

Under general supervision, incumbents establish and maintain 
schedules for the production of publications; route jobs through 
scheduling, editing, writing, design and distribution, obtain 
approvals for type selections; and may supervise related 
personnel.

Typically at this level incumbents schedule and maintain flow of 
jobs; assist in the selection of printers and binders; contact 
customers for approval of changes in format, including brownline 
approval before printing; coordinate changes between customers 
and creative services to effectively relate the purpose of the 
publication; and may assist in the reorganization of reports and 
illustrations.

Publications Coordinator

Under supervision, incumbents assist in the performance of the 
duties as outlined in the series concept.

Typically at this level incumbents help plan and expedite 
production schedules; review publication needs and report daily 
status of work progress or delays; and may prepare specifications 
for new publications and advise in print production 
specifications.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

Principal Publications Coordinator

Two years of college and five years of experience in the 
coordination and production of publications; or an equivalent 
combination of education and experience; and knowledges and 
abilities essential to the successful performance of the duties 
assigned to the position.
